In an old industrial area of about 19,000 m², the Autonomous Province of Trento not only asked Renzo Piano for a museum but a center for reflection on the relationship between nature and man. And so MUSE was born. So successful that, as the only Italian museum, it received an honorable mention at the European Museum of the Year Awards 2015.
From the mountains to the challenges of sustainability, from the first humans to the secrets of DNA. With “special effects” to experience the same emotions as climbing the Dolomite walls or free skiing down.
At the same time, it is possible to touch fossils and minerals, use the microscope, enter the large greenhouse with live plants from the forests of Tanzania.
Also, the fossilized footprints of dinosaurs from the Alpine region, the first painted stones, and the weapons of prehistoric hunters from the Ice Age.
In a science gym, the principles of physics and mechanics are learned through interactive installations.
